                                                                                  CHAMPAGNE FOR THANKGIVING….

Champagne is best served at the beginning of your Thanksgiving dinner and can be enjoyed during and through the meal. Drinking Champagne with red or white wine during the meal is perfectly fine. 

Krug Grande Cuvee
This Champagne always makes its presence in a huge way. Its deep golden color and tiny fine bubbles amplify fullness and rich elegance. Aromas of flowers and ripe dried fruit, marzipan, gingerbread and citrus fruit. Combine with flavors of hazelnut, nougat, barley sugar, and jellied citrus fruits. Ending finish has hints of almond and honey.

Veuve Clicquot Brut
One of the most popular of all Champagnes. Aromas of lemon freshness, dried peach, and floral apple. Combining with rich flavors of apricot, brioche and hints of a creamery mandarin citrus finish.

Moet & Chandon Imperial Brut
A nice, elegant yellow straw color. With aromas of bright fresh apple, pear, peach. Hints of honey and lime. On the palate rich smooth mandarin, with hints of pear and finishing on a light dry appeal.

Nicolas Feuillatte Reserve Brut
Golden pale color. With aromas of fruit such as white fruit, pear, apple, almond and hazelnuts. Flavors of pear, apricot finishing on a medium body and light acidity.

Duval Leroy Brut Reserve
Medium body with notes of apple and lemon combining on light citrus, brioche and nutty almond and honey. Finish.

Drappier Blanc de Blanc
Forward white peach and pear on the nose. On the palate biscuity, hints of green apple, citrus lemon, lime, almond and toast.

ROSE CHAMPAGNES

Veuve Clicquot Rose
Beautiful color with pinkness.   The nose ripe red fruit, strawberry and hints of grapefruit, ginger. With all combining for a balanced. On the finish a complex yet delicate touch of tannis balancing off smooth acidity.

Ruinart  Rose Brut
A pomegranate color and lively tiny bubbles. On the nose exotic fruit and small red fruit, strawberries, raspberry. On the palate silky balanced red fruit, strawberry orange and rich creamery pastry with hints of spice

Drappier Rose Brut
Lightly dry with bright raspberry and strawberry on the nose. With flavors of balanced red fruit strawberry raspberry finishing with smooth tannis.

Duval Leroy Rose Brut
A salmon color. On the nose structured freshness of red fruit. Tasting balanced flavors of raspberry and red fruit finishing on light acidity.

Lanson Rose
Pale salmon color. Aromas of rose, peaches, strawberries. Combining with tangerines, red fruit, finishing on a medium bodied and balanced tannis.
Nicolas Feuillatte rose Reserve
Light pinkness in the color. Bursting with ripe and red fruit on the nose. Tasting delicious flavors of red current, blueberry, raspberry and hints of strawberry finishing medium body.
